Output 2545796e6c0e6496a3ba4420e4037468d886b765d5efe918475bf8deec56bf4a:6

value
84814011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0f47aad2617e5b0f42c9a4f3c24ff9476eaf7d5 OP_EQUAL
address
MRVQqyUfTVC6mWr8U3Nn7U2qDDS1iaDzq1
transaction
2545796e6c0e6496a3ba4420e4037468d886b765d5efe918475bf8deec56bf4a
spent
true